What Does a Ship Engineer Do?
As a ship engineer, your duties include the operation and maintenance of a ship’s engine, boiler, pump, generator, and other machinery. You are also responsible for supervising and coordinating crew tasks in the maintenance and operation of the ship. Your responsibilities may include starting a ship’s engine to propel the ship, controlling the speed as ordered by the captain or bridge computers, and fixing any components that need immediate repair. As a ship engineer, you may also be in charge of reporting any issues to the appropriate staff onboard and maintaining records regarding engine activities and maintenance.

What is the difference between Ship Engineer vs Marine Engineer?
| Aspect | Ship Engineer | Marine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Engineering degree, certifications in marine systems | Engineering degree, marine certifications |
| Work Environment | Onboard ships, shipyards | On ships, marine repair facilities |
| Industry Usage | Shipbuilding, shipping companies | Ship maintenance, marine services |
Ship Engineers and Marine Engineers often share similar credentials and work environments, focusing on maintaining and repairing ship systems. The main difference lies in their specific roles: Ship Engineers typically oversee the entire engineering department onboard ships, while Marine Engineers may work more broadly in marine repair and maintenance outside of ships. Both roles are essential in the maritime industry and often overlap in skills and certifications.

PORT ENGINEER
Patriot Maritime is a leading maritime contractor to the U.S. Government, managing and operating vessels. Headquartered in Webster, TX, Patriot is looking for Port Engineers in conjunction with the contract requirements for Military Sealift Command (MSC) and our commercial fleet.
An active SECRET level security Clearance or the ability to obtain a SECRET level security clearance is required.
Responsibilities & Authorities:
Oversee the safe and economic operation of an assigned group of vessels and cost-effectively manages the assigned
Manage day-to-day vessel-related problems including operational, technical support and safety areas, providing supervision and handling crew-related
Manage daily operations according to the Safety and Quality Management
Monitor the incidents and reports submitted by assigned vessels via the Docmap program and respond with comments, resolutions, corrective actions as necessary. Provide closure to incidents/reports in the SQMS within specified response times.
Periodically review the Class vessel report for deficiencies and relevant date-specific requirements.
Work with assigned vessel personnel to ensure they operate according to the policies, procedures, and performance standards of
Member of the Incident Response Team (IRT) for any vessel casualty they are
Conduct accident or near miss
Maintain familiarity with Company's Employee Injury and Illness Prevention Program (IIPP), as described in SQMS and requirements for completing Vendor/Visitor Familiarization Checklist prior to beginning work on the
Ensure that the Chief Engineer reviews and signs off on all vendor service reports and conducts a personal physical review when possible. The Port Engineer may take on this responsibility for the Chief Engineer when
In consultation with the Chief Engineer, physically inspect the preventive maintenance records in SAMM and manage Planned Maintenance Industrial Assist (PMIA) w/in SAMM.
Maintain awareness of outstanding USCG 835 deficiencies and Port State Control findings, and report current status and progress on any required tracking
Qualifications:
- Possess a minimum of three years' experience as a Port Engineer having managed and negotiated at least two shipyard dry-docking availabilities with a value greater than three million dollars. Experience gained while employed by a shipyard or while serving active duty in the military may be applicable towards meeting this requirement if the duties and responsibilities of the positions are substantially the same as a Port Engineer. This experience shall demonstrate their ability to effectively manage and negotiate complex projects such as shipyard dry dock overhauls and other types of repairs.
- Possess a minimum of four years' experience serving aboard Government or commercial ocean-going ships of not less than 4,000 HP as either a Chief Engineer or a First Assistant Engineer. This experience shall demonstrate effective management of maintenance and repair of ocean-going ships.
Possess minimum of seven years' total experience that is comprised of one or more of the following:- An engineering related degree (e.g. Marine Engineer, Marine Architecture; Mechanical Engineering).
- A Bachelor's Degree will count for three years' total education experience.
- A Master's Degree or higher will count for an additional one year of experience.
- Engineering Degree(s) will count for no more than four years' total experience.
- Experience gained while employed by a shipyard in a management position
- Serving active duty in the military performing duties substantially the same as a Port Engineer
- This experience shall demonstrate their ability to manage and negotiate complex projects such as shipyard dry dock overhauls and other types of repairs on ocean-going ships.
Strong communication skills both written and verbal
Good project management skills, including strong decision-making, problem-solving and strategic planning abilities
Strong time management skills
Intermediate knowledge of the MS Office Suite, MS 360 and SharePoint required
An active SECRET level security Clearance or the ability to obtain a SECRET level security clearance is required
The ability to travel up to 15% per year, and up to 50% during shipyard years.
